Duricef
Common use
Duricef belongs to the cephalosporin family of drugs, it causes bactericidal effect violating cell wall formation. It acts against a broad spectrum of gram positive bacteria like Staphylococcus. (both producing and non-producing penicillase) Streptococcus and gram negative microorganisms (Shigella, Salmonella, Escherichia coli, Haemophilus influenzae, Klebsiella, some strains of Proteus). This medication is used to treat infections of respiratory system, urinary tract, pelvic organs, skin and soft tissues, osteomyelitis, eye infections, etc. which are caused by susceptible microorganisms as well as for prevention of endocarditis, infectious complications after surgery.
